Publisher Description: CHASING PLASTIC is a young adult fiction sports story that is a fast-paced read for teenaged readers, written with both hesitant and avid readers in mind. When her best friend Trina comes back from camp talking-up her experiences with ultimate frisbee, fifteen-year-old Kate is less than enthusiastic about Trina's newest passion. Still, she reluctantly joins Trina at tryouts for their high school ultimate team and is soon thrown head first into the sport. Kate struggles with the game, watching, often quite literally, from the sidelines as Trina finds success on the field. As the season progresses, Kate faces an increasingly rocky relationship with her best friend, her mother's unexpected illness, and the looming reality of failing her first term of grade ten. Despite her difficulties embracing the game, Kate ultimately finds the support and compassion she needs to get through her hardest challenges with her new teammates. They become her confidantes, tutors, and greatest supporters when she needs them the most. In the ultimate team, she finds a community where she belongs. |
